CVE-2025-1332

2.4 · LOW
Published Feb 16, 2025 xjd2020 CWE-79 EPSS 0.36% (29th pctl)

Overview

CVE-2025-1332 is a low-severity vulnerability affecting xjd2020 fastcms. It was published on February 16, 2025 and has a CVSS 3.1 base score of 2.4 (LOW).

This vulnerability has a CVSS 3.1 base score of 2.4, rated LOW. It can be exploited remotely over the network. Some level of privileges is required for exploitation.

Technical Description

A vulnerability has been found in FastCMS up to 0.1.5 and classified as problematic. This vulnerability affects unknown code of the file /fastcms.html#/template/menu of the component Template Menu. The manipulation leads to cross site scripting. The attack can be initiated remotely. The exploit has been disclosed to the public and may be used. Continious delivery with rolling releases is used by this product. Therefore, no version details of affected nor updated releases are available.
